LVM简单配置总结

lvm  操作步骤:
1、找块空的硬盘 ,分区sdd1和sdd2。用t 改变system  id ,为8e,(lvm),w保持退出。

2、pvscan
3、pvcreate  /dev/sdd1   生成pv
4、vgcreate  vg1   /dev/sdd1  把pv(dev/sdd1)创建为一个vg1的卷组
5、lvcreate   -L  10M  -n  lv1  vg1   把vg1里面的10M的空间划分出来创建lv1。
6、格式化lv1   mkfs.ext3  /dev/vg1/lv1
7、挂载lv1    mount  /dev/vg1/lv1   /mnt/lv1
8、可以正常使用lv1
改变lv的大小
方法一:在未使用lv的时候,可以通过lvextend  扩展,需要先卸载,再扩展,再格式化,最后重新挂载。
lvextend  -L  +20M  /dev/vg1/lv1  增加20M
lvreduce  -L  -10M  /dev/vg1/lv1   减少10M
方法二:在已使用lv的时候,可以通过resize2fs  无损扩展,无需重新挂载,无需格式化。
lvresize  -L  200M  /dev/vg1/lv1
先设定大小为200M
lvresize  -L   +10M  /dev/vg1/lv1
带+  意思是在原有基础上面增加10M
resize2fs  /dev/vg1/lv1
这条命令是执行重定义尺寸操作

将逻辑卷data扩容20M,注意有+和没+的区别,有+是将逻辑卷增加了20M,没+是将逻辑卷增加到20M,区别很大

改变vg大小
通过增加pv到vg中,来增加vg的总容量
步骤:
1、pvcreate  /dev/sdd2
2、vgextend  vg1   /dev/sdd2
上面是我个人总结实验的基本步骤,现在给一张拓扑图 ,便于理解操作!

发表评论

电子邮件地址不会被公开。 必填项已用*标注